要连接外部数据库,你可以使用Docker中的网络功能来连接外部数据库。下面是连接外部MySQL数据库的步骤示例:
创建一个Docker网络:
docker network create mynetwork
启动外部数据库容器:
docker run -d --name mymysql --network=mynetwork -e MYSQL_ROOT_PASSWORD=password mysql
在Docker容器中连接外部数据库:
docker run -it --network=mynetwork mysql mysql -h mymysql -u root -p
这将在Docker网络mynetwork
中启动一个容器,并使用mysql
命令连接到外部数据库容器mymysql
。你可以根据实际情况调整连接参数,例如设置用户名、密码和数据库名称。
请注意,上述示例中使用的是MySQL数据库作为外部数据库,你可以根据实际情况调整命令和参数来连接其他类型的数据库。